It was a nitrous express new nozzle system adjustable up to 600 hp. I currently had the 200 jets in it running fine. I think that a nos noid got stuck open running the power straight thru melting a wire keeping it active and then filled the motor with nos and 116 octane fuel and must of found a spark and boom.
